One of the most frequent problems that can be encountered with uPVC windows is that they become difficult to lock or open. This problem usually occurs when the locking mechanism is stiff or stuck. If this is the case, a simple fix is to apply graphite powder or machine oil to grease the lock and handle mechanism. This will allow the mechanism to free up and the window or door to operate normally once more.

The hinges can become stiff or even stuck. This issue is usually caused by dust and grit building up on the hinges. Lubricating the hinges with grease or oil is the solution. A poor lubricant could damage the hinges and render them unusable.

Stained Glass Repairs

Stained glass windows are beautiful features in homes, churches and other buildings. They provide visual interest and add privacy to a space. They can be fragile and require constant care to ensure they are in good shape. Even with proper care, stained and lead glass windows deteriorate as time passes due to age and exposure to weather and other environmental elements. This causes a range of issues, including cracks, fading, and water leakage. It is essential to locate a local expert to restore your stained or leaded window to its original glory.

The cost of repairing damaged or cracked stained-glass is $500. The exact price will depend on the type of solution required to fix the problem. A professional might employ copper foil or epoxy edge-gluing to repair the broken glass. They can also relead lead cames and seal stained glass. There are a variety of options each having their own pros and cons. The best solution will depend on the size of the crack, location and the kind of material used in the production of the glass.

Leaded glass cracks may be caused by vibrations, thermal expansion or contraction and building movements, or UPVC Window Repairs Near Me just normal wear and tear. Cracks can grow larger and cause more problems as time passes. A crack in a crucial feature or in the face of stained glass panels must be repaired as soon as possible to prevent further enlargement and damage. Years ago, this was usually done by splicing in an "Dutchman" lead flange on top of the crack. This was not a good method of repair and is no longer the case. There are much better ways to fix cracks of this type.

Stained glass restoration can take many forms. It could be as simple as repairing cracks, or as complex as restoring an entire stained glass door or window panel to its original state. In general, the cost of a restoration project is considerably more than that of replacing or repairing a damaged piece. The work includes cleaning and removing damaged glass, tightening lead cames, resealing the cement and re-tying, and replacing stained glass pieces that are missing.

Weatherstripping Repairs

Weatherstripping stops water and air from entering homes through gaps surrounding doors and windows. It is an important element of home maintenance that can save you money on costs for energy and repairs that are costly. It can also make a home more comfortable. However, the materials used in this seal can deteriorate over time due wear and tear, which makes it important to replace the seals from time to time.

You can tell the weather stripping is been damaged by noticing a wet spot after washing the windows, a whistling sound when driving down the road or a draft you can feel in front of the door that is closed. These are all good indications to find a Tasker in my area who can provide weatherstripping repair.

Taskers can protect your doors and windows by using a variety of weatherstripping materials. Foam tapes are made of open or closed-cell foam and come in a range of widths, thicknesses, and quality to accommodate all kinds of cracks. They are easy to install and cut by cutting. Felt strips are likewise inexpensive and usually last for up to a year. You can cut them to size with scissors, and attach them to the door frame, hinge side, or sliding windows using staples, glue or tacks. Vinyl or metal V-strips are a little more complicated to put in place, but they can be secured with nails into the window jamb.

One of the most common issues that occur with double-paned windows is the fogging of the glass. This is caused by a malfunction of the airtight seal that joins the two panes of glass. Re-sealing of the glass might be able to fix the issue, depending on the cause. If the window has been exposed for a prolonged period to the elements, it may be necessary to replace the entire unit.
